Comprehending Shipping Container Sizes
Shipping containers can be found in numerous dimensions to accommodate the diverse needs of transport and storage. The most typical sizes include:
| Container Size | Internal Length (ft) | Internal Width (ft) | Internal Height (ft) | Capacity (Cubic Feet) | Typical Use |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| 20 ft | 19.4 | 7.7 | 7.9 | 1,172 | Typical for numerous items |
| 40 ft | 39.4 | 7.7 | 7.9 | 2,390 | Suitable for large shipments |
| 40 ft High Cube | 39.4 | 7.7 | 8.5 | 2,694 | Extra height for bulky items |
| 45 ft | 44.4 | 7.7 | 8.5 | 3,041 | Big volume deliveries |
| 30 ft | 29.4 | 7.7 | 7.9 | 1,690 | Specialized and customized usage |
The 30-ft Shipping Container: A Closer Look
Although a 30 Foot Storage Container-ft shipping container is not as typical as the standard sizes, manufacturers do produce them, mostly as customized choices tailored for particular needs. These containers offer a middle ground in between the common 20-ft and the bigger 40-ft containers, offering additional storage capability without requiring the extensive space a 40-ft container needs.
Why Choose a 30-ft Container?
Area Efficiency: A 30-ft container is a fantastic choice for those who discover a 20-ft container too small for their needs but don't need the complete space of a 40-ft one. This size makes it perfect for domestic relocations, temporary storage, or even small industrial applications.
Cost-Effectiveness: Companies wanting to lease or buy shipping containers often discover that a 30-ft container strikes a balance in between cost and space requirements.
Versatility: The 30-ft container can be utilized in a variety of settings, including shipping, storage, and even as a modular area in construction.
Typical Uses of 30-ft Shipping Containers
- Mobile Offices: Many companies use these containers as mobile workplaces or task site storage, gaining from their mobility.
- Storage Solutions: Ideal for companies requiring extra storage without committing to a larger-size system.
- Pop-up Retail: Retailers can use 30-ft containers to create short-lived retail spaces or stores.
- Workshops: These containers can be converted into workshops or hobby studios, offering extra space for tools and equipment.
Accessibility
While 30-ft shipping containers are less common than their 20-ft and 40-ft counterparts, they are still offered through many shipping container manufacturers and providers. They can usually be found in new, used, or refurbished conditions, enabling versatility based on spending plan and requirements.
